1. History and Evolution of on-line poker Ranking:

Internet poker ranking methods initially appeared during the early 2000s, shortly after the poker boom. In the past, platforms like Sharkscope and formal Poker Rankings (OPR) gained popularity by monitoring and displaying people’ tournament results and profits. These methods primarily focused on offering statistics to greatly help players analyze their particular performance and get an edge over their particular opponents.

But as internet poker became much more competitive, ranking methods began integrating additional elements such as leaderboard competitions and player rating systems. This shift aimed to foster a feeling of competition, pressing people to strive for higher positioning and recognition from their peers.

2. Several Types Of On-line Poker Ranking Techniques:

Today, people get access to numerous on-line poker ranking systems that use diverse methodologies in evaluating people' shows. Although some systems give attention to money online game outcomes, other individuals prioritize tournament accomplishments or a variety of both.

One popular standing system could be the international Poker Index (GPI), which gained extensive recognition due to its impartial and accurate assessment practices. The GPI makes use of a scoring formula that weighs in at tournaments' buy-ins, field sizes, and players' finishing opportunities. Consequently, the device provides a target ranking that ranks people based on their particular constant overall performance in prestigious real time tournaments.

In addition, online systems including PocketFives and Sharkscope provide positions based on players' on line tournament shows solely. These platforms monitor people' results across a number of on-line poker sites, allowing people to compare their particular performance against others in internet poker neighborhood.
